Technical Field

[0001] This utility model relates to the technical field of waste gas treatment devices, and in particular to a waste gas treatment device using continuous rolling of special-shaped steel. Background Technology

[0002] Continuous rolling of special-shaped steel refers to a process in which steel billets of different shapes and specifications are gradually deformed through a series of roll passes arranged on a continuous rolling line, ultimately rolling them into special-shaped steel products of the required shape and size. These special-shaped steels typically have complex cross-sectional shapes that are not circular or square, such as I-beams, channel steel, H-beams, and angle steel. The continuous rolling process generates waste gas, which requires effective treatment to meet environmental protection requirements.

[0003] In existing technologies, traditional waste gas treatment devices may not be able to fully utilize the packing layer when spraying waste gas, easily resulting in spray dead zones, which affects waste gas treatment efficiency and the service life of the packing. Furthermore, in terms of equipment maintenance, disassembling critical components such as the packing layer can be cumbersome, potentially leading to prolonged equipment downtime and impacting the overall waste gas treatment process. This invention aims to overcome these problems in existing technologies and provide a more efficient and easier-to-maintain waste gas treatment device for continuous rolling mills of special-shaped steel. [0032] The operating method and working principle of this device are as follows: During use, alkaline liquid is added to the inside of the tank 2 through the liquid inlet pipe 3. Then, waste gas is discharged into the tank 2 through the waste gas inlet pipe 5. At this time, the motor drives the stirring rod 21 and stirring blades 22 to stir the waste gas, ensuring thorough mixing between the waste gas and the spray liquid. For the neutralization reaction between acidic gases and alkaline spray liquid in the waste gas from the continuous rolling of special-shaped steel, stirring greatly increases the contact opportunities between the reactants, accelerates the reaction rate, and thus improves the purification effect of the entire waste gas treatment device.

[0033] The purified exhaust gas rises through the air guide plate 9 into the packing layer 8. At this point, the motor A12 can be started to rotate the threaded rod 13, thereby moving the atomizing spray plate 11 horizontally. Simultaneously, the atomizing spray plate 11 slides on the surface of the guide rod 10, making its movement more stable. This horizontal movement of the atomizing spray plate 11 ensures uniform spraying of the packing layer 8, avoiding spray dead zones, improving the effective utilization rate of the packing, and extending its service life. When it is necessary to release the packing layer 8, simply pull the limiting block 16, causing it to move along the sliding rod 17 and slide out from inside the sliding strip 14. At this time, the tension spring 19 provides an outward force, causing the top block 20 to push out of the packing layer 8.

[0034] It can unlock the packing layer 8, thereby enabling rapid disassembly of the packing layer 8, which reduces equipment downtime and ensures the continuous and efficient operation of the waste gas treatment device.
